Security and Access Settings Guide

This guide explains each security and access setting in the system, including its purpose, where it’s found, the available options, and typical use cases.


Setting: Tenant Supervisory Setting

Purpose:
Notifications routed to the direct supervisor. Supervisors only have access to the people they are tied to through the supervisor file.

Where to Find It:
Data Integration

Options:

  • Normal
    – Supervisor file is used to manage supervisor-based notifications without limiting access to records.
  • Restrictive
    – Allows the supervisor to view all members in their group but prevents group members from viewing the supervisor.
    (For Restrictive to work, “All Persons Access” must be set to “No” for the supervisor role.)

Setting: All Users in this role have access to all persons at their location

Purpose:
Toggle classes/supervisor group settings vs See all persons who have a record at their location(s)

Where to Find It:
Clevr Page Rights

Options:

  • On
    – Role has access to records for all students and staff at the location.
  • Off
    – Role has access only to students/staff aligned to them in the Groups and Classes data (from SIS or Supervisor file).

Setting: Records will be displayed across all locations person is assigned. 

Purpose: 
Automatically add the person/record to the listings card for all locations the person is connected to. 

Where to Find it: Form Settings


Setting:  Auto Create Record 

Purpose:
Automatically create a record for all people in the limited roles setting.

Where to Find It:
Form Settings


Setting: Limited Roles

Purpose:
Records can only be created for these roles.

Where to Find It:
Form Settings


Setting: Record Access Rights

Purpose:
Controls which records the role has access to.

Where to Find It:
Form Settings / Role

Options:

  • Public
  • Exclude Subject of Form
  • Guardians Only


Setting: Role cannot add new person to this form. 

Purpose:
Ability to search the “Add” screen and add a new record for a person.

Where to Find It:
Form Settings / Role


Setting: Form Rights

Purpose:
Specifies which areas of the form the role has access to.

Where to Find It:
Form Settings / Role

Options:

  • Full and Editor Access
  • Full Access
  • Read Only
  • No Access

Setting: Users in this role are assigned to all locations

Purpose:
Users have access to forms within all locations. The users’ records are available from all locations.

Where to Find It:
Role Settings


Setting: All Person Status Access

Purpose:
Ability to see persons who are preregistered, active/inactive, and transferred out.

Where to Find It:
Role Settings/Page Rights


Setting: Users in this role can configure Dashboards for this form

Purpose:
Allows users to add, remove, and arrange the cards on their dashboard.

Where to Find It:
Dashboard – Edit

Options:

  • Yes
  • No

Setting: Person Management Module

Purpose:
Allows users to manage user accounts (roles, locations, user account details, linked accounts). Allows admin users to manage person records for students, parents, locations, and staff.

Where to Find It:
Page Rights


Setting: Configuration Module

Purpose:
Allows users to manage roles, rights, and access to features and form permissions.

Where to Find It:
Page Rights
